Are there any allergy considerations when purchasing Costco’s chocolate cakes?

When purchasing any baked good from Costco, including their chocolate cakes, it’s crucial to be mindful of potential allergens. Chocolate cakes often contain common allergens such as wheat (gluten), dairy, eggs, and soy. Traces of nuts may also be present due to shared equipment in the bakery.

Always carefully review the ingredient list and allergen information provided on the cake’s packaging. If you have any specific allergies or dietary restrictions, it’s best to contact the bakery staff at your local Costco to inquire about the ingredients and potential cross-contamination risks. They can provide you with more detailed information to help you make an informed decision.

How long do Costco’s chocolate cakes typically last?

Costco’s chocolate cakes are best enjoyed within a few days of purchase to ensure optimal freshness and flavor. They are typically baked fresh in-store, and while they don’t contain excessive preservatives, they will eventually start to dry out or lose their flavor intensity. Storing them properly can help extend their shelf life.

To maintain the cake’s quality, store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ator. This will help prevent it from drying out and absorbing odors from other foods. If you need to store the cake for longer than a few days, you can also freeze it. Wrap individual slices or portions tightly in plastic wrap and then place them in a freezer-safe bag or container. Frozen cake can typically be stored for up to 2-3 months without significant loss of quality.
